I am currently Orchestra Director at Arcadia High School (boasting one of the largest school string programs in the state) and the Conductor of the Pasadena Youth String Orchestra. I have been teaching private violin lessons since I was 14 years old and have taught students of all ages--from 4 years old to 50 years old. I am easy-going, have a great sense of humor, have a great ear (perfect pitch) and can pay great attention to detail. My strictness and demand levels for my private students are dependent upon how serious about music you are--whether you are doing it just for fun or to prepare for a career as a musician. I am also the President and Founder of Crescendo Young Musicians Guild, a non-profit youth music education and community service organization. Background ~Northwestern University: Bachelor of Music in Music Education with Department Honors. Instrumental and General Music concentrations. Lesson Information Lessons available for violin (beginning through advanced), viola (beginning through intermediate), piano (beginning), conducting (beginning through intermediate), and music theory/ear training.
